titleOfInvention | A nanoparticle for folate-targeted, its purposes and synthesis and detection method |
abstract | The present invention relates to a kind of nanoparticle of folate-targeted, its purposes and synthesis and detection method.After antitumor drug administration, in non-specific distribution in body, toxic and side effects is large, and therapeutic index is low.Pharmaceutical carrier-the nanoparticle with active targeting function adopting nanotechnology to build, can effectively address this problem.Folic acid is conventional targeted molecular, and bootable medicine active targeting, containing the tumor cell of folacin receptor, improves drugs against tumor effect.The present invention selects plant sterol. and sodium alginate builds the Performances of Novel Nano-Porous grain of rice plant sterol-sodium alginate nanoparticles of folate-targeted, hydrophobic antitumor drug amycin bag is loaded in its hydrophobic inner core, be prepared into the nanoparticle of medicine carrying, make sodium alginate, new material that plant sterol becomes antineoplastic drug carrier, plant sterol-the sodium alginate nanoparticles of self assembly has safety, effectiveness and targeting as antineoplastic drug carrier, for it is applied to clinical providing fundamental basis as a kind of new drug carrier in the future. |
